    Think Yogurtland but with slime-making (scents, added knick-knacks, food coloring, etc.). We were invited for a birthday party. It's cute. You can buy premade slime or make your own. You choose your slime (didn't realize there's various types of consistencies until coming here), and I guess your various toppings. The girls helping were friendly enough and patient with a bunch of loud kids. Unsure with the value since we were party guests, but my kid enjoyed it enough that he wants to go back and make slime again. It's cute. It's messy. It's for kids. It's fun. I'd return for my kid.

    My son really loves slime, so Slimeatory was basically slime paradise for him. He was so excited to see all the diff textures of premium slimes, scents, charms, and merch. They offer pre-made slimes you can buy, or you can visit the DIY slime bar for a fun experience! My little guy chose the cloud slime because it's fluffy, and he picked green and teal for the colors, as his favorite is aquamarine. He also decided on cookies scent, which was adorable. I personally loved the apple scent, but of course, it's all about him. Lol You get to select 5 toppings like glitter, charms, foam beads, and sprinkles, and then you get to name your slime. The slime barista, Alexa, I believe, was fantastic and made the experience even more special. Izzy rate it 5/5! ;)

    Cool slime store! Pricey but fun experience allowing kids to pick their own slime texture, color, scents, 5 accessories and make a label for the slime. Price tag 26.99 + tax. There are other slime kits and slime for sale in the store. Located in the second floor of the brea mall.
